Leeds United are looking for their first home league win of the 2023/24 season after a promising run of form on the road under Daniel Farke.

Watford arrive at Elland Road this weekend under the watchful eye of former Barnsley and West Bromwich Albion boss Valerien Ismael. Leeds boss Farke, meanwhile, is in search of three points in LS11 for the first time since taking the United job back in July.

Additionally, Leeds could make it four consecutive clean sheets after shut-outs against Sheffield Wednesday, Millwall and Hull City, however the team will be without on-loan Tottenham Hotspur defenders Joe Rodon and Djed Spence, through suspension and injury, respectively.

Willy Gnonto is another absentee for Leeds this afternoon after sustaining an ankle ligament injury at the MKM Stadium in midweek.

67’ Goal No. 4 in a Leeds shirt for Joel Piroe. Georginio Rutter the architect, spinning away from two challenges inside the centre circle and finding James wide right. Welshman pings a lovely cross into Piroe’s path at the back post. Slots it. One-nil.

61’ Piroe shoots from inside the D after Summerville gallops past Sierralta in the middle again. Over the crossbar, though. Leeds’ press today has been very good, Watford given no breathing room despite not seeing too much of the ball.
